Indian Canyons

First stop, Andreas Canyon, the second largest palm oasis in North America where you will take an approximate 30-minute nature walk. The tour is filled with information on plants, animals, native lore, and history.

Next stop, Palm Canyon, home to over 3,000 native palms, forming an incredible canopy with breathtaking vistas of the oasis and valley below. At the trading post, you can purchase that special souvenir and snacks.

Learn how the native people, our own Cahuilla Indians, thrived on the desert floor for many hundreds of years. Visit a “kish” and “ramada” to learn how early housing was possible in a natural palm oasis. Be intrigued, standing atop a massive “metate” where mothers and daughters worked side by side to prepare family meals.

Rich & Famous Tour

Learn history and facts about the playground of the Hollywood stars. Your entertaining guide will regale you with stories and play a fun game of “Guess The Stars Homes.” This area is comprised of all custom homes and boast an amazing collection of fascinating architecture including the popular midcentury modern homes.

Elvis Presley not only honeymooned here but also owned a lovely estate where he and his “posse” could enjoy the warm and dry desert weather. Frank Sinatra built “Twin Palms” and is buried locally. Dean Martin, Liz Taylor, Dinah Shore, Liberace, Ronald Reagan, Frederick Lowe, Zsa Zsa Gabor, Alan Ladd, Debbie Reynolds, Marilyn Monroe…and dozens more came to bask in the warm sun and soak in the free and easy desert life style.

Windmill Best of the Best Tour

When driving into the beautiful Coachella valley, one of the most striking sights you will see is the vast array of wind turbines that sprout from the desert floor. The words “wind turbine” have evolved into what the locals call windmills. Undoubtedly, that view will pique your curiosity.

Their expert guide will answer your questions and provide interesting background on the subject. You will get an introduction to the weather and geology of the area, learn why windmills were built in California, and why the wind blows the way it does in this mountain pass.

You’ll be stopping at some of the projects where you will get information about the windmills themselves, how big they are, how they work, and the unique features of the different designs and models of windmills. Your last stop will be a power plant in the desert where you will learn about the economics and politics of wind energy in California and around the world.

Modernism 101 Tour

Come join us on the fun and fascinating tour of the midcentury modern design, architecture and the culture in Palm Springs.

Catch glimpses of the iconic Albert Frey-designed Tramway Gas Station, Richard Nertra’s 1946 Kaufmann Desert House and the mass-produced but stunning alexander homes. They will take you through the city’s diverse neighborhoods and see the many treasures and tell all the fascinating history of Palm Springs. You will see homes by noted architects, celebrity homes, film locations, preserved commercial buildings and public architecture.
